Company Overview

We provide knowledgeable, reliable personnel, prepared to serve!

Our workers are proficient in: Moving, carpentry, electrical services, plumbing, gardening, landscaping, weeding, digging, yard care, painting, repairs, handyman services, garage cleanup, debris removal, hauling, construction, heavy labor, gutter cleaning, house cleaning, window washing, sewing, and distributing flyers.

Hiring Steps:
1. Contact us at (650) 903-4102, complete our online form, or visit during business hours.
2. Let us know the job specifics, the number of workers needed, the date/time, and the location.
3. The starting hourly pay is $25 per worker (this may differ based on the job).
4. Pick up the workers at the Center (if you cannot pick them up, we will try to arrange alternatives; you can also request a ride-sharing service for the worker).
5. Compensate the workers at the job's conclusion and return them to the Center.

The Day Worker Center of Mountain View is a non-profit organization that connects day laborers with employers in a safe and reliable environment. Created by local business owners, community members, and church leaders to deliver job-matching services for many local homeowners and businesses each year, we aid employers in discovering dependable, skilled, and friendly workers while empowering workers to improve their socio-economic status through education, advocacy, and job training.

Every worker and employer is registered with the Center, and many share a long history of reliable and respectful service. The Center seeks feedback from every employer and tracks the performance of each worker. Both sides benefit from an organized hiring system, transparent pay expectations, and a bilingual team to facilitate communication.

The Center imposes no fees on workers or those who hire them.
